The first established English colony in North America was Jamestown, Virginia. There were 13 original colonies in the United States.
Common law came to America from English settlers who arrived in the early colonies. It is based on legal principles developed in England over centuries and continued to be used as the foundation of the legal system in the American colonies and later in the United States.
